![]() ![]() In the second form of the command, INFILE and OUTFILE are the first and second positional (non-option) arguments. If '-' is used for INFILE or OUTFILE, stdin or stdout will be used. The output type and filename are specified with the -o OUTTYPE and -F OUTFILE options. The input type and filename are specified with the -i INTYPE and -f INFILE options. Usage: gpsbabel -i INTYPE -f INFILE -o OUTTYPE -F OUTFILE gpsbabel -i INTYPE -o OUTTYPE INFILE OUTFILE Converts GPS route and waypoint data from one format type to another. Provided by: NAME gpsbabel - GPS route and waypoint data converter DESCRIPTION GPSBabel Version 1.5.2.
